Performance of Carbon Nanotube/Polysulfone (CNT/Psf) Composite Membranes during Oil-Water Mixture Separation: Effect of CNT Dispersion Method

Abstract

Effect of the dispersion method employed during the synthesis of carbon nanotube (CNT)/polysulfone-infused composite membranes on the quality and separation performance of the membranes during oil-water mixture separation is demonstrated. Carbon nanotube/polysulfone composite membranes containing 5% CNT and pure polysulfone membrane (with 0% CNT) were synthesized using phase inversion. Three CNT dispersion methods referred to as Method 1 (M1), Method 2 (M2), and Method 3 (M3) were used to disperse the CNTs. Morphology and surface property of the synthesized membranes were checked with scanning electron microscopy (SEM) and Fourier-transform infrared (FTIR) spectroscopy, respectively. Separation performance of the membranes was evaluated by applying the membrane to the separation of oil-water emulsion using a cross-flow filtration setup. The functional groups obtained from the FTIR spectra for the membranes and the CNTs included carboxylic acid groups (O-H) and carbonyl group (C=O) which are responsible for the hydrophilic properties of the membranes. The contact angles for the membranes obtained from Method 1, Method 2, and Method 3 were 76.6° ± 5.0°, 77.9° ± 1.3°, and 77.3° ± 4.5°, respectively, and 88.1° ± 2.1° was obtained for the pure polysulfone membrane. The oil rejection (OR) for the synthesized composite membranes from Method 1, Method 2, and Method 3 were 48.71%, 65.86%, and 99.88%, respectively, indicating that Method 3 resulted in membrane of the best quality and separation performance.
